脑室灌注β-淀粉样肽致痴呆动物模型

摘    要:目的 建立脑室灌注 β 淀粉样肽 (Aβ)致痴呆动物模型及观测指标。方法 微泵渗透对动物脑室进行灌注可溶性大片段Aβ ,侧脑室一次性注射聚集态小片段Aβ,侧脑室一次性注射可溶性大片段Aβ片段 ,侧脑室注射Aβ联用转化生长因子β(TGFβ)。 结果 上述方法处理后动物水迷宫和被动回避操作能力受损 ,学习和记忆功能损害 ,皮层和海马中胆碱乙酰转移酶 (ChAT)活性明显降低 ,抗氧化能力下降 ,海马神经元坏死或缺失 ,凋亡相关蛋白酶Bal 2、Bax和p5 3增加等。结论 上述方法均可选用来作为模拟AD病理特征的动物模型。

The dementia models induced by intracerebroventricular infusion of β-Amyloid peptide in mice

Abstract:Aim To establish the dementia mice models induced by intracerebroventricular infusion of β-Amyloid peptide and related measuring index. Methods The mice models were made by intracerebroventricular infusion of long fragment of solubleβ-Amyloid peptide with micropump, intracerebroventricular injection of long solubleβ-Amyloid peptide fragment and short insoluble β-Amyloid peptide fragment,and intracerebroventricular injection of β-Amyloid peptide combining with transforming growth factor. Results Compared with normal control, the learning and memory ability was decreased in all above model mice. the ChAT activity in both hippocampus and cortex of model mice decreased, the hippocampal neuron were depleted and the content of apoptosis associated protein Bal-2?BAX and p53 were increased. Conclusions All above mice models could be choose as the dementia models which were simulating the pathological charactoristics of the Alzheimer's disease.
